Item 8.01 Other Events.

As previously reported, under News Corporation's (the "Company's") stock repurchase program (the "Repurchase Program"), the Company is authorized to acquire from time to time up to $1 billion in the aggregate of the Company's outstanding shares of Class A common stock and Class B common stock. Under the rules of the Australian Securities Exchange (the "ASX"), the Company is required to provide to the ASX, on a daily basis, disclosure of transactions pursuant to the Repurchase Program, if any. The Company also discloses information concerning the Repurchase Program in the Company's quarterly and annual reports.

Attached as Exhibit 99.1 and Exhibit 99.2 are copies of the information provided to the ASX on the respective dates noted on Exhibit 99.1 and Exhibit 99.2.
